Engine & Transmission
The Orion is a front-wheel drive car powered by a 2.0-liter, 4-cylinder, naturally aspirated engine producing 133 horsepower and 185 Nm of torque. It features a 4-speed automatic transmission and a coil spring suspension system.

Brakes
The Orion car model comes equipped with ventilated disc brakes in the front and drum brakes in the rear, ensuring reliable stopping power. The car features a steering rack and pinion system with hydraulic power steering for smooth handling. The 185/65 R14 tires and 14-inch wheel rims provide a comfortable ride. Additionally, the car is equipped with an Anti-lock Braking System (ABS) for enhanced safety.

Weight & Capacity
The Orion is a well-balanced car with a weight-to-power ratio of 9.2 kg/Hp and 108.8 Hp/tonne, indicating a good balance between power and weight. The car has a kerb weight of 1222 kg and a fuel tank capacity of 62 liters. The trunk boot space is adjustable, with a minimum of 550 liters and a maximum of 1840 liters.
